The Mother of All Monitors


The Mother of All Monitors 05/21/2004 05:21 PM

If a 23 inch diagonal flat panel monitor just isn't big enough for you, how about strapping four of them together for a panoramic, Grand Canyon-like view?

With its ultra-widescreen format, phenomenal image quality, stunning aluminum construction and spectacular high-resolutions, the new Grand Canyon Displays are the ultimate solution for any creative professional, medical, military, engineering, modeling, high-end audio/video editing, TV Broadcast applications, and graphics-intensive computing needs.

You too can have the Cinerama on your desktop for a mere $18,000. Oh, and don't forget the three additional video cards you'll need to drive it, which of course requires that you've got a machine with expansion slots to spare.

This monitor array is only one of the many slightly quirky products that can be found at the Lieberman Go-L website (is that pronounced "go-el", or "gol" as in "golly"?) It's interesting to poke around on the website; many high-end computing devices and peripherals, priced higher than even Apple's wares. All on a website that bears a striking resemblance to Apple's own (I wonder if Apple Legal has seen that site yet.)

How Much Power do LCD Monitors Save?


How Much Power do LCD Monitors Save? 06/01/2004 06:01 AM

How much do you save with LCD monitors?: My wife and I are slowly switching our entire house over to flouresent light bulbs — you know, those spiral looking things? We're doing this because we're sick and tired of changing burnt out incandescent bulbs, and these are supposed to last so much longer. They also use a lot less power. The bulbs I got are meant to replace 60-watt incandescent bulbs, yet they use just 23 watts. Bonus.

This got me thinking about power consumption, and then about LCD monitors, since they apparently use much less power than an equivalent CRT. I have a 19" CRT that has served me well, but is getting a little dimmer with every passing month. I thought, if I I could prove significant power savings, then perhaps my wife would let me buy a nice, new flat panel.

I found this article over at CNet which, sadly, doesn't quite prove my case, but is interesting nonetheless. The savings are there, but they're not quite enough to justify a 17" LCD (about $400 minimum), which I would need to equal the screen area of my 19" CRT. Too bad.

...the approximate cost of using the LCD 24 hours a day is $3.74 per month. If you use this device for three years, the extended power cost for the life of the device would be $134.78.

By comparison, if you had a CRT device consuming 90 watts with the same usage requirements, its monthly power consumption would be $6.48, and its three-year usage cost would be $233.68. So simply using the LCD device for the same requirement over three years of 24-hour usage would give a savings of nearly $100. In locations with high energy costs (such as California), this savings can exceed $130 over the three-year term (assuming a $0.14 rate).

You also have to consider that these calculations assume the monitor is running 24 hours a day, which mine isn't. It's more like two hours. So that puts my power savings down to less than $10 over three years.

Just the other day, however, I visited a brand new customer service call center. They had all brand new equipment, including 15" LCDs on each desk. I wondered at the time how they could justify the purchase of LCDs when they're still twice as much as CRTs and desk space didn't seem to be an issue. But when you consider that these monitors are on 24 hours a day, perhaps the power savings is enough to influence the decision.

NewsFire monitors news, bl0gs, more


NewsFire monitors news, bl0gs, more 12/29/2004 01:48 PM
Australian developer David Watanabe has released version 0.5 of NewsFire, his RSS (Really Simple Syndication) reader that enables you to monitor news sites, blogs and other online publications that offer RSS feeds. The new version adds title and summary list styles and allows you to hide feeds as well as select smart feeds as a condition in other smart feeds. NewsFire supports the RSS and Atom feed formats and imports and exports OPML, the standard file format for news feeds. You can also import feeds from another newsreader. The software is still in Beta and is a free download; Watanabe plans on ultimately releasing it as shareware.

Sharp offers two new 17-inch LCD
monitors


Sharp offers two new 17-inch LCD
monitors
06/03/2004 12:24 PM
Sharp Systems of America has announced two new 17-inch LCD displays, the LL-172G and LL-172A. The displays both feature 1280 x 1024 native resolution, 300-nit brightness and 450:1 contrast ratio. They also sport 16ms response time, color management capabilities and different brightness modes to help conserve power. A slide height and swivel adjustment system is built in, and the displays come in black or white chassis options. The US$499 LL-172G sports both an analog mini D-sub 15-pin connector and a DVI-I connector, while the $479 LL-172A is an analog-only display.
